> Standalone session clusters are redeployed instead of scaled in-place
> ---------------------------------------------------------------------

> Currently, the {{StandaloneFlinkService#scale}} exposes 2 issues that break 
> the TaskManager in-place rescaling:
>  # The JobSpec is not correctly extracted. (this one was introduced in 1.6.0 
> operator version)
>  # The replica comparison is performed on an Integer object reference instead 
> of the boxed value.
> Those 2 code issues outline the following real problems:
>  - Changing {{spec.taskManager.replicas}} on a standalone session cluster 
> produces a full redeploy instead of in-place scale.
>  - For 128 replicas or more, two equal counts are distinct objects, so the 
> operator issues a redundant scale call on every reconcile loop and the "not 
> scaling" branch becomes unreachable.
> Those 2 problems were not seen because the UTs that were backing them were 
> well implemented and structured.
